What is a key reason for having an AI inventory?

Having an AI inventory is crucial for attaching risk scores to each system because it allows organizations to systematically evaluate and manage the potential risks associated with their AI implementations. An AI inventory provides a comprehensive overview of all AI systems being used, their purposes, and their operational contexts. By understanding what AI systems are in place, organizations can assess factors such as data privacy, algorithmic fairness, and compliance with regulations, enabling them to allocate appropriate risk scores.

This proactive approach to risk management helps organizations identify vulnerabilities and areas of concern, ensuring that measures can be taken to mitigate risks before they manifest into larger problems. It also supports transparency and accountability within the organization by fostering an informed understanding of how AI systems operate and the consequences they may bring.

In contrast, while improving marketing strategies, streamlining hiring processes, and reducing costs are all potential benefits of AI, they do not specifically relate to the fundamental governance practice of assessing and managing the risks associated with AI technologies.
